Revolving stools are specifically designed to accommodate the needs of healthcare professionals who often find themselves moving swiftly between patient beds, equipment, and medical charts. Their ergonomic design allows users to maintain a healthy posture while working, thus reducing the risk of musculoskeletal injuries. With features like adjustable height and swivel functionality, these stools promote mobility without straining the body. Nurses, doctors, and other healthcare staff can easily rotate to attend to different tasks without the need to stand up or awkwardly reposition themselves, improving their efficiency during busy shifts.

One of the most notable aspects of rehabilitation physical therapy is its diverse range of techniques and modalities. Patients may engage in exercises aimed at strengthening weakened muscles, improving flexibility, and enhancing balance and coordination. Manual therapy techniques, such as joint mobilization and soft tissue manipulation, are also employed to alleviate pain and restore function. Additionally, therapists often utilize modalities like heat, cold, ultrasound, and electrical stimulation to enhance healing and provide relief.

In addition to traditional wheelchairs, there are specialized options designed for various situations. For example, sports wheelchairs are engineered for athletes, providing lightweight frames and specialized wheels for optimal performance on the court or track. Similarly, all-terrain wheelchairs are built to handle various terrains, enabling users to explore outdoor environments that may have been previously inaccessible.

A: A hospital bed at home can be a valuable tool to promote rest and healing. Whether recovering from an injury or in-patient stay, or adjusting to mobility limitations, you can enjoy improved health, increased independence, and a positive impact on quality of life with the addition of a hospital bed at home. The knee and head adjustability offer improved incontinence support, easy sanitization helps create a healthy environment, and repositioning options decrease the risk of pressure ulcers and provide comfortable postural support. Safety features like side rails or mattresses with bolsters can also minimize the risk of falling out of bed, as does height adjustability.

Foldable shower chairs come in various designs, materials, and colors to fit individual preferences and needs. From lightweight aluminum frames to more robust models made of durable plastic, users can find a chair that suits their demands. Some even come with added features such as armrests, back support, and padding for extra comfort, making them an appropriate choice for longer use.
